Human population genetic research (HPGR) seeks to identify the
diversity and variation of the human genome and how human group and
individual genetic diversity has developed. This book asks whether
developing countries are well prepared for the ethical and legal
conduct of human population genetic research, with specific regard
to vulnerable target group protection. The book highlights
particular issues raised by genetic research on populations as a
whole, such as the potential harm specific groups may suffer in
genetic research, and the capacity for current frameworks of
Western developed countries to provide adequate protections for
these target populations. Using The People's Republic of China as a
key example, Yue Wang argues that since the target groups of HPGR
are almost always from isolated and rural areas of developing
countries, the ethical and legal frameworks for human subject
protection need to be reconsidered in order to eliminate, or at
least reduce, the vulnerability of those groups. While most
discussion in this field focuses on the impact of genetic research
on individuals, this book breaks new ground in exploring how the
interests of target groups are also seriously implicated in genetic
work. In evaluating current regulations concerning prevention of
harm to vulnerable groups, the book also puts forward an
alternative model for group protection in the context of human
population genetic research in developing countries. The book will
be of great interest to students and academics of medical law,
ethics, and the implications of genetic research.
